Calculation of initiation pressure of vertical well for coalbed methane considering crack characteristic index

Abstract: In order to explore the influence of fracture characteristics index on crack initiation pressure in vertical well and solve the problem of theoretical calculation about vertical well initiation pressure. First of all, the vertical well initiation pressure model is established based on the principles of fracture mechanics and elastic mechanics, considering the characteristics of primary fractures and fracturing fluids. Secondly, the influence of primary crack characteristics on initiation pressure is analyzed quantitatively; meanwhile, proposing the concept of "crack characteristic index control coefficient T" and deriving the mathematical expression of T. At last, sensitivity analysis of the primary crack characteristic parameters is made for the initiation pressure. It is concluded that the most sensitive factor affecting the initiation pressure is the crack width b. When b is in the range of 100-700 μm, the fracture characteristics of the formation have the practical significance for the initiation pressure, which solves the problem of the choice of fracturing target layer. The results show that: The influence factors of vertical well initiation pressure are related not only to the mechanical properties of the source rock, the stress field, the fracturing fluid properties and the well size, but also the width, length, density and roughness of the crack. Especially the small fluctuations in the width of the crack will cause vertical wells crack pressure changes. According to the actual geological prospecting data and fracturing construction data of the 5 test wells in Jiaozuo mining area, the vertical well initiation pressure is calculated and verified. It is found that the actual initiation pressure is in good agreement with the calculated results. It is shown that the theoretical model has some guiding significance for the actual control of the vertical well initiation pressure.

Key words: fractured coal, fracture characteristic index, initiation pressure, control coefficient, sensitivity analysis
